WebEmotions in the arts affect us on a subjective and bodily level which influences aesthetic evaluations, e.g, liking. Thus, emotions in the arts are not only represented in a perceiver via a cognitive or detached mode, as often implicated by cognitivistic art theories. In Ann Hamilton’s The Event of a Thread, large swings hang from the tall ceiling of Manhattan’s Park Avenue Armory. can a p plater drive a turboWeb6 mrt. 2024 · The most ancient use of art was as a vehicle for religious ritual . Art has always supported religion, from prehistoric cave paintings in France to the Sistine Chapel. Throughout history, the Church has been the principal supporter of artists.
